Why Traditional Command Line Tools Fall Short
Legacy utilities like khtml2png, CutyCapt or PhantomJS once felt revolutionary. Yet today they struggle with modern rendering engines, CSS3 effects and asynchronous content loads. Here’s why:
- Limited JavaScript support: Many CLI tools can’t execute complex scripts, so interactive menus or maps render blank.
- Manual timing and waits: You script arbitrary sleep delays, then pray that content finished loading.
- Environmental complexity: You spin up a VNC server or Xvfb, manage DISPLAY variables and debug obscure display errors.
- Inconsistent quality: Output resolution, cropping and scroll stitching often need post-processing in ImageMagick or GIMP.
In short, command line screenshot tools demand maintenance, add fragility and can’t adapt on the fly. For true end-to-end screenshot automation AI, you need an intelligent layer that handles every detail for you.
